“構建持續(xù)穩(wěn)定的服務器集群”
本文將介紹如何構建一個持續(xù)穩(wěn)定的服務器集群,為企業(yè)或個人提供高質(zhì)量、高可用性的網(wǎng)絡服務。從硬件、軟件、網(wǎng)絡架構和監(jiān)控管理四個方面詳細講解,幫助讀者深入了解構建穩(wěn)定服務器集群的相關技術和方法。
1、硬件配置篇
服務器硬件配置是構建一個高穩(wěn)定性的服務器集群的重要基礎。首先需要選擇高性能的服務器硬件,包括CPU、內(nèi)存、存儲等方面。其次,需要為服務器集群配置高速穩(wěn)定的網(wǎng)絡環(huán)境。例如以sftp服務器時間為準的穩(wěn)定文件傳輸解決方案,可以使用交換機實現(xiàn)服務器的互聯(lián),提高數(shù)據(jù)傳輸速度。此外,合理配置RAID磁盤陣列可以提高數(shù)據(jù)的安全性和讀寫速度。其次,需要為服務器設備提供可靠的電源保障,包括UPS和發(fā)電機等設備的備選。還需要定期進行硬件維護,檢查和更新操作系統(tǒng)版本和驅(qū)動程序等,以保證硬件設備始終處于穩(wěn)定可靠的狀態(tài)。
最后,為了提高可靠性,推薦采用負載均衡設備,增加集群節(jié)點數(shù),確保在單個節(jié)點故障時,其他節(jié)點能夠頂替服務。
2、軟件配置篇
服務器軟件配置是構建一個穩(wěn)定服務器集群的重要因素。首先,需要選用穩(wěn)定、安全的操作系統(tǒng)和服務程序,例如CentOS、Apache、Nginx等。對于數(shù)據(jù)庫等重要服務,需要考慮使用主從復制或者集群方式提高可用性和穩(wěn)定性。其次,服務器軟件需要嚴格管理服務進程和端口。對于服務進程,需要選用類似systemd等進程管理工具,實現(xiàn)開機自啟、故障自動恢復等功能。對于端口,需要避免未授權的端口訪問,并定期更新相關的訪問控制列表。
此外,還需要為服務器集群配置高效的緩存和防火墻等安全機制,確保業(yè)務的穩(wěn)定性和數(shù)據(jù)的安全性。
3、網(wǎng)絡架構篇
服務器集群的網(wǎng)絡架構也是構建穩(wěn)定服務器集群的關鍵?;诜掌骷簭碗s的網(wǎng)絡連接,需要設計合理的網(wǎng)絡架構,提高內(nèi)部的網(wǎng)絡容錯能力。首先,需要實現(xiàn)負載均衡器和高可用性集群解決方案,確保在單個節(jié)點出現(xiàn)故障時,能夠無縫地切換到其他節(jié)點上。
其次,需要配置高效的網(wǎng)絡服務,如交換機、路由器等,確保統(tǒng)一地址、安全性、可管理性和可擴展性,規(guī)范網(wǎng)絡服務的應用,并監(jiān)控網(wǎng)絡性能和問題。
最后,服務器集群需要靈活配置,可以根據(jù)業(yè)務規(guī)模的擴大和業(yè)務發(fā)展的需求進行擴展和調(diào)整,以確保業(yè)務的可持續(xù)性和穩(wěn)定性。
4、監(jiān)控管理篇
服務器監(jiān)控和管理是確保服務高可用性的關鍵。需要采用有效的監(jiān)控手段,定期收集監(jiān)控數(shù)據(jù),確保及時發(fā)現(xiàn)故障,并及時處理。監(jiān)控數(shù)據(jù)可以包括服務器的負載、CPU、硬盤故障率等。必要時,可以采用自動化應急響應機制,自動處理故障。其次,需要定期進行系統(tǒng)和軟件的巡檢和維護,包括檢查磁盤空間、服務進程、日志記錄等。同時,需要定期備份重要數(shù)據(jù)和配置文件,防止數(shù)據(jù)丟失或運維人員操作失誤導致?lián)p失等后果。
最后,對于一些重要的業(yè)務系統(tǒng),推薦進行安全審計,確保系統(tǒng)安全可靠,以及業(yè)務數(shù)據(jù)的安全性和可用性。
總結:
本文從硬件、軟件、網(wǎng)絡架構、監(jiān)控管理四個方面詳細闡述了構建持續(xù)穩(wěn)定的服務器集群所需要的重要因素。硬件部分強調(diào)使用高性能、可靠的硬件,軟件部分則著重于安全性和穩(wěn)定性。網(wǎng)絡架構部分,介紹了如何實現(xiàn)負載均衡器和高可用性集群解決方案。監(jiān)控管理部分,介紹了如何實現(xiàn)有效的監(jiān)控手段和應急響應機制。未來,隨著互聯(lián)網(wǎng)和數(shù)字經(jīng)濟的不斷發(fā)展,服務器集群技術將變得越來越重要。